sideline

verb/ˈsaɪdˌlaɪn/

Frequency rank: #9,405 most common English word

Meaning

to remove someone from active participation; to keep out of action.

Illustration for the English word “sideline”

Example sentence

The coach decided to sideline the star player after his poor performance last week.
